Be Prepared to Respond with Confidence

The Emergency First Responder (EFR) course at Lak Scuba equips you with essential CPR and first aid skills that can make all the difference in emergency situations—whether at home, in the workplace, or underwater.

Designed for both divers and non-divers, this internationally recognized course builds the knowledge and confidence needed to respond effectively during medical emergencies. It fulfills the CPR and first aid training requirements for the PADI Rescue Diver course and all PADI professional-level certifications.

Whether you’re continuing your PADI journey or simply want to be prepared to help others, the EFR course is a vital step in becoming a capable and confident responder.

What You’ll Learn

In this comprehensive, scenario-based training, you’ll learn to:

  • Conduct Primary Care (CPR) techniques for adults

  • Deliver Secondary Care (First Aid) for minor injuries and illnesses

  • Operate an Automated External Defibrillator (AED)

  • Manage bleeding, choking, and spinal injuries

  • Care for shock victims and assess emergency scenes

  • Communicate effectively with emergency medical services (EMS)

  • Apply bandages, splints, and illness assessments

  • Respond to adult, child, and infant emergencies (optional)

Course Overview

Duration: ~6–8 hours (typically 1 full day)

Format: Instructor-led training + role-playing + video tutorials

  • EFR Participant Manual or Digital eLearning Access
  • Practice equipment (CPR mannequins, AED trainers, bandaging tools)
  • EFR Certification valid for 2 years

Modules:

  • Primary Care (CPR)
  • Secondary Care (First Aid)
  • Optional: AED Use
  • Optional: Care for Children
